About

The main purpose of the protocol is to collect and evaluate performance data after patients undergoing various interventional endoscopy procedures performed at H. H. Chao Comprehensive Digestive Disease Center (CDDC).

Full description

In general, the outcome data includes clinical management, hospitalization, and complications; to determine costs associated with endoscopy procedures; to determine performance data including technical success, procedure time, rate of repeat interventions; to compare endoscopy performance and outcome data collected at University of California, Irvine (UCI) and results from other institutions previously published in the literature. Additional parameters might be collected for specific interventional endoscopy procedures.
